New Delhi, Oct. 17 -- The ministry of statistics and programme implementation (MoSPI) on Friday sought public feedback on the draft questionnaire for the first-ever Annual Survey of Incorporated Service Sector Enterprises (ASISSE), set to launch in January.

The survey aims to bridge a critical data gap in India's formal service sector, which accounts for over half of the nation's GDP and employs millions.

While data on unincorporated service businesses is regularly collected, there has been a lack of consistent information on incorporated service enterprises, particularly with breakdowns by industry and state or Union territory.
